During World War II, non-naturalized Italian men over the age of 16 in Britain were held in internment camps. One of the pieces in the exhibition Belonging by Susan Aldworth, in which she explores the immigration of her grandparents from Italy to London in the 1920. An oriundo (plural oriundi) is an Italian, or person of Italian descent, living outside Italy. One of the pieces in the exhibition Belonging by Susan Aldworth, in which she explores the immigration of her grandparents from Italy to London in the 1920.
